Stephen Wolfram is a British and American mathematician, physicist, and computer scientist. Born in London in 1959, he was educated at Eton College, the Dragon School, St John's College, and the California Institute of Technology. He has served as a university teacher and is employed by Wolfram Research and the University of Illinois Urbana–Champaign. Wolfram is a member of the American Mathematical Society and the American Academy of Arts and Sciences, and he has received the MacArthur Fellows Program award.

His work spans mathematics, physics, and computer science, with influences from Alan Turing and Joel Moses. Notable publications include *Mathematica: a system for doing mathematics by computer* and works on cellular automata and complexity. He resides in Cambridge and Concord.

Stephen Wolfram is a distinguished scientist, inventor, author, and business leader. He is the creator of Mathematica, the author of A New Kind of Science, the creator of Wolfram|Alpha, and the founder and CEO of Wolfram Research. His career has been characterized by a sequence of original and significant achievements. Born in London in 1959, Wolfram was educated at Eton, Oxford, and Caltech. Stephen Wolfram (/ˈwʊlfrəm/ WUUL-frəm; born 29 August 1959) is a British-American computer scientist, physicist, and businessman. He is known for his work in computer algebra and theoretical physics. In 2012, he was named a fellow of the American Mathematical Society.
